Dave At Night
$6.99 pb
By Gail Carson Levine
Newbury Award winning author tells a heart felt story loosely based on her
own father's childhood in the Hebrew Orphan Asylum in the 1920's. When Dave's
father dies, he lands in an orphanage set in Harlem, far from the life he knew
on the Lower East Side. Inside the orphanage are strict rules, constant bullying
and tasteless gruel. At night he escapes to the outside world of of Harlem,
alive with jazz musicians, swindlers, exclusive parties and mystifying
strangers. Somewhere among both places, Dave finds true friendship, in this
inspirational and colorful novel.
